CAH Hedge Fund Activity: Q3 2020 in Review

740 of the 4,956 institutional investors tracked by Wall St. Rank reported a position in Cardinal Health (CAH) for Q3 2020, worth a combined $11.6B — down 12% from $13.2B a quarter earlier.

Sellers outnumbered buyers: 89 funds closed out of CAH and 69 opened new positions — a net loss of 20 holders — while 302 trimmed existing stakes and 254 added.

The largest buyer was Citadel Advisors, adding an estimated $84.8M. The largest seller was Ameriprise, cutting an estimated $172M.
